Verse 1A
Thy hand, O God, has guided Thy flock from age to age; The wondrous tale is written Full clear on every page;
Verse 1B
Our fathers owned Thy goodness, And we their deeds record; And both of this bear witness, One church, one faith, one Lord.
Verse 2A
Thy heralds brought glad tidings To greatest as to least; They bade men rise and hasten To share the great King’s feast:
Verse 2B
And this was all their teaching, In every deed and word, To all alike proclaiming One church, one faith, one Lord.
Verse 3A
When shadows thick were falling, And all seemed sunk in night, Thou, Lord, did send Thy servants, Thy chosen sons of light.
Verse 3B
On them and on Thy people Thy plenteous grace was poured, And this was still their message: One church, one faith, one Lord.
Verse 4A
Thy mercy will not fail us, Nor leave Thy work undone; With Thy right hand to help us, The vict’ry shall be won;
Verse 4B
And then by men and angels Thy name shall be adored, And this shall be their anthem: One church, one faith, one Lord.
